Backflow preventer installation services involve the setup of devices designed to protect potable water supplies from contamination caused by reverse water flow. These devices are typically installed at critical points within a property’s plumbing system to ensure that wastewater, chemicals, or other pollutants do not flow back into the clean water supply. Professionals specializing in backflow preventer installation assess the property’s plumbing layout, select appropriate devices, and correctly install them to meet local regulations and standards. Proper installation is essential for maintaining water quality and preventing potential health hazards associated with contaminated water.
This service addresses common plumbing issues related to backflow, such as cross-connections between potable water lines and non-potable sources like irrigation systems, fire suppression systems, or industrial processes. Without a backflow preventer, these connections can allow contaminated water to seep into the main water supply, risking public health and property safety. Installing a backflow preventer helps mitigate these risks by providing a barrier that stops reverse flow, ensuring that drinking water remains clean and safe. Regular testing and maintenance of these devices are also recommended to ensure continued protection.

The overview below groups typical Backflow Preventer Installation projects into broad ranges so you can see how smaller, mid-sized, and larger jobs often compare in Great Falls, VA.
In many markets, a large share of routine jobs stays in the lower and middle ranges, while only a smaller percentage of projects moves into the highest bands when the work is more complex or site conditions are harder than average.
Installation Cost - The typical cost for backflow preventer installation ranges from $300 to $1,200, depending on the system size and complexity. For example, a standard residential unit may cost around $500, while more advanced setups could be higher.
Material Expenses - The price of backflow preventers varies between $50 and $300 for common models. Higher-end or specialized units can cost up to $600 or more, influencing the overall installation cost.
Labor Charges - Labor fees for installing a backflow preventer generally fall between $150 and $500. Costs depend on the project's scope, site accessibility, and local rates charged by service providers.
Additional Costs - Extra expenses may include permits, which can range from $50 to $200, and any necessary system modifications. These costs vary based on local regulations and specific job requirements.
Actual totals will depend on details like access to the work area, the scope of the project, and the materials selected, so use these as general starting points rather than exact figures.

What is a backflow preventer? A backflow preventer is a device installed in plumbing systems to prevent contaminated water from flowing back into the clean water supply.
Why is backflow preventer installation important? Installing a backflow preventer helps protect drinking water from potential pollutants and ensures compliance with local plumbing codes.
Who should handle backflow preventer installation? Licensed plumbing professionals or qualified service providers are recommended to perform backflow preventer installation services.
How long does backflow preventer installation typically take? The installation process generally takes a few hours, depending on the system's complexity and location.
Can existing systems be upgraded with a backflow preventer? Yes, existing plumbing systems can often be retrofitted with a backflow preventer to enhance water safety.
